
Schiller256
Mitglieder-
Gesamte Inhalte
1547 -
Benutzer seit
-
Letzter Besuch
Inhaltstyp
Profile
Forum
Downloads
Kalender
Blogs
Shop
Alle Inhalte von Schiller256
-
Antrag FiAe (Frage zu Fremdleistungen)
Schiller256 antwortete auf GuntiNDDS's Thema in Abschlussprojekte
Im Antrag selbst würde ich da nicht so detailliert drauf ein gehen. Nenne es und sage kurz was es macht und beschreibe deine Aufgabe im Projekt. Das sollte reichen. In deiner Dokumentation erklärst du es dann etwas genauer und grenzt es zu deiner eigenen Leistung ab. Die Entwicklungsumgebung und den DB-Server wenn überhaut nur nennen. -
Das schaut so aus als willst du von einem String auf eine Klasse/ Interface IBuddyPolicy casten. Das wird so nicht gehen da String deine Klasse/ Interface nicht kennt. Gib mal den Entsprechenden Code da kann man besser sehen was du vor hast.
-
Ein Rechtesystem muss geplant und auch umgesetzt werden und das sehe ich im Moment nicht. Es fehlt in der Zeitplanung sowohl die Zeit das Rechtesystem zu planen als auch in der Realisierung das Rechtesystem umzusetzen. Wenn du das auch noch umsetzen willst in deinem Projekt. Dann solltest du dir eventuell überlegen nur das Backend zu machen. Denn dass das Projekt in 70 Std. zu realisieren ist glaubt dir sicherlich kein Prüfer. Denn so wie es im Moment da steht werden das mindestens 100 Std. wenn nicht sogar noch deutlich mehr. Das liegt weit über dem was du in deinem Projekt an Zeit hast.
-
Könnt etwas viel für 70 Std. sein. Denn ich lese im Antrag etwas von Rollen basierten Rechten kann dann aber in der Zeitplanung nichts dauu finden. Wird das auch von dir umgesetzt? Für deine Umsetzung hast du dir selbst nur 16 Std. gegeben das bedeutet das du in zwei Tagen sowohl Frontend als auch Batch Backend umsetzen willst das halte ich für nicht Realisierbar auch wenn du noch so gut planst. Was du auf jeden Fall machen solltest ist die Abkürzungen ausschreiben denn nicht jeder kann damit was anfangen. Der letzte Absatz in deinem Punkt 1.1 ist irrelevant. Ab du das Projekt nun für einen oder Tausend Kunden umsetzt ist für das Projekt egal.
-
Wie bekomme ich in ANT bei javac generics auf jdk 1.4?
Schiller256 antwortete auf Salitor's Thema in Java
Wie wäre es wenn du uns ein paar mehr Infos zu Serena gibst. Was du genau mit Ant und Serena zusammen machen willst ist mir auch nicht klar. -
Installer programmieren(win xp/linux)
Schiller256 antwortete auf colisa's Thema in Abschlussprojekte
Ist das Kind denn nun schon in der Brunnen gefallen oder kannst du noch was retten. Also hast du den Antrag schon angegeben und er ist genehmigt oder bist du noch nicht so weit? Wenn du noch an deinem Antrag arbeitest suche dir was auch was dir liegt und wo du sicher bist. Ich halte eine Installer der auf mehreren Systemen laufen soll für ein 70 Std. Projekt doch für etwas zu anspruchsvoll. Zumal du wie du schon selbst geschrieben hast noch recht wenig Erfahrung mit Installern und mit dem Programmieren im allgemeinen hast. Java ist da auch nur bedingt eine Lösung denn du brauchst auf dem System mindestens eine JRE in der passenden Version. Das kann schon recht schnell zu einem Problem werden. -
Weshalb die java.exe gefunden wird und die javac.exe nicht ist recht einfach deine Umgebungsvariablen zeigen nicht in das bin Verzeichnis deiner jdk Installation sondern ins bin Verzeichnis des mit ausgelieferten jre. Da liegt aber keine javac Datei. Also: jdk1.6.0_04 |-bin <- hier sollte die Umgebungsvariablen hin zeigen | |-java.exe | |-javac.exe | |-jre |-bin |-java.exe <- diese Datei wird über die Umgebungsvariablen gefunden
-
Continous Build/Integration als Anwendungsentwickler
Schiller256 antwortete auf zui2000's Thema in Abschlussprojekte
Ein reines einführen ist in meinen Augen nichts für einen FIAE das ist eher was für eine FISI. Zumal dann hier auch noch ein Vergleich mit anderen Tools mit eingebaut werden müsste. Was noch hinzu kommt ist das es sich so anhört als wäre das Projekt bereits durchgeführt. Dann kannst du es nicht als Abschlussprojekt nutzen denn dein Antrag muss vor der Umsetzung genehmigt werden. Ein Projekt was bereits durchgeführt wurde kann nicht als Abschlussprojekt eingereicht werden. Was du machen könntest wäre eine Erweiterung des CI Tools in deinem Projekt also zusätzliche Plugins oder ähnliches erstellen und einbinden nur hier muss geschaut werden ob es für 70 Stunden reicht. -
Fahrradtouren mit GPS Tracking usw.
Schiller256 antwortete auf U-- °LoneWolf°'s Thema in Small Talk
Kannst dir ja mal OpenCycleMap.org - the OpenStreetMap Cycle Map anschauen da sind ein paar Touren/ Strecken drin. Ebenfalls ganz interessant zum Thema Tracking von Strecken ist das Wiki von Main Page - OpenStreetMap. Hier sind auch ein paar Programme für den PDA aufgeführt um Stecken aufzuzeichnen. -
Name einer privaten Variablen zur Laufzeit ermitteln
Schiller256 antwortete auf mkScheller's Thema in Java
Ja! Auch wenn du nicht danach gefragt hast hier mal ein kleines Beispiel. import java.lang.reflect.Field; import java.lang.reflect.Modifier; public class ReflectionTest {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method stub Class clazz = PoJo.class; for (Field field : clazz.getDeclaredFields()) { System.out.print("FieldName: " + field.getName()); System.out.println(" - Modifiers private " + Modifier.isPrivate(field.getModifiers())); } } public class PoJo { private String attribut1; private int attribut2; public String getAttribut1() { return attribut1; } public void setAttribut1(String attribut1) { this.attribut1 = attribut1; } public int getAttribut2() { return attribut2; } public void setAttribut2(int attribut2) { this.attribut2 = attribut2; } } } -
Naja, es wäre vielleicht hilfreich gewesen zu wissen welche Eclipse Version du einsetzt und auch was für Plugins du geladen hast. Hier auch mit Versionsnummern. Hast du die Meldung die du bekommst auch schon mal befolgt? Also in die log Datei geschaut was da drin steht? Die findest du in (dein Pfad zum Workspace)/.metadata/.log. Da kannst du mal nach den letzten Stacktraces suchen und mit dessen Hilfe mal google befragen. Oder sie hier posten damit wir dir weiter helfen können. Aber bitte nur den relevanten Teil und nicht die gesamte Datei! Das ganze schon mal ohne die zusätzlichen Plugins versucht? Also "Eclipse IDE for Java EE Developers" in der aktuellen Version (3.4) laden und installieren. Dann deinen JBoss Application Server laden und installieren. Im Eclipse unter Windows -> Preferences -> Server -> Runtime Environments deinen JBoss eintragen und dann ein neues J2EE Projekt anlegen und deinen JBoss als Target Runtime auswählen. Anschließend in der Server View einen neuen Server einrichten also wieder auf deine Runtime verweisen. Doppelt auf den Server klicken und dann mal schauen was bei Publishing steht eventuell anpassen. Dann deinen Server starten und das EAR dem Server zuweisen.
-
Komplette Produktbeschreibungen gehören nicht in den Anhang hier reicht es einen Link auf die Herstellerseite zu setzen. Bei Links bitte nicht das Datum vergessen. Es müssen sämtliche Informationen die nicht von dir sind auch mit Quellen belegt werden.
-
Wenn die Möglichkeit besteht das Programm noch zu beenden dann mach das auch. Schau dir deinen Antrag nochmal an und überlege ob du eine nicht so wichtige Komponente weg lassen kannst oder durch geschicktes umschichten der Zeiten etwas mehr für die Realisierung hast. Aber nicht an der Planung sparen und dann trotzdem nicht fertig werden. Wenn in deinem Programm "nice to have" Komponenten fehlen die aber im Antrag eventuell schon beschrieben wurden dann begründen wieso sie nicht umgesetzt werden konnten. Ist für mich aber kein Grund jemanden in diesen Prüfungsteil nicht bestehen zu lassen. Wenn das Programm gar nicht läuft oder sich von NullPointerException zu NullPointerException hangelt dann erst recht in der Dokumentation begründen wieso das Projekt so verlaufen ist wie es verlaufen ist. Aber auch hier muss es nicht unbedingt sein das dieser Prüfungsteil als nicht bestanden gezählt wird.
-
Was heißt nicht fertig programmiert? Geht das Programm gar nicht, fehlen wichtige Bestandteile oder fehlen "Nice to have" Komponenten? Dann kommt es noch auf die Begründung in der Dokumentation an. Gib mal ein paar mehr Informationen so pauschal kann man das nicht sagen.
-
Der Scanner stellt dir den Barcode als Zahlen-/Buchstabenfolge zur Verfügung. Meist senden die Scanner nach erfolgreichem scann noch ein Enter mit damit ist das erfassen kein Problem mehr. Du musst nun im Access Programm/Makro diese Zahlen-/Buchstabenfolge nur noch zerlegen und per Insert in die Datenbank bringen. Eventuell vorher noch einen Select ob genau dieser Datensatz schon vorhanden ist. Wen ja dann Meldung ausgeben. Sollten alle Bestandteile aus dem Barcode in der Datenbank Unique sein dann kannst du auch aufgrund des Fehlgeschlagenen Insert's die Meldung erzeugen.
-
Wäre erstmal schön zu wissen welchen XML Parser du verwendest? Denn mit dem Code kann ich nichts anfangen. Wieso willst du nicht das bearbeitete XML per HTTP versenden? Denn das würde es dem Empfänger eventuell erleichtern damit umzugehen.
-
Dur braucht dafür eine entsprechende Library die dir den Zugriff auf die Office Formate von Microsoft gewährt. Ich wende meist Apache POI - Java API To Access Microsoft Format Files lässt sich recht einfach bedienen und ist auch für komplexere Aufgaben zu gebrauchen.
-
Also das löschen und anschließende Kompilieren der Software ist sicherlich nicht der Richtige Weg um heraus zu finden welche Bibliotheken du brauchst. Denn du bist ja inzwischen lebst schon drauf gekommen das klassen erst zu Laufzeit geladen werden. Hinzu kommt das Bibliotheken auch selbst wieder Abhängigkeiten untereinander haben können. Dir wird wohl initial nichts anderes übrig bleiben als in Dokumentationen nach zu lesen welche Bibliothek welche Abhängigkeiten haben.
-
Was willst du denn genau machen? Für den Anfang würde doch sicherlich ein Emulator von deinem gewünschten Zielhandy vollkommen reichen.
-
Wäre vielleicht ganz gut wenn du etwas genau werden könntest um was für Basissoftware es sich da handelt. Was du da mit irgendwelchen Scripten machen willst ist mir auch noch schleierhaft. Ich kann auch nicht so recht verstehen was du mit XML-Objekt meinst. Hast du denn nur den Objekt-Baum oder kannst du z.B via XPath dir erstmal nur bestimmte Elemente/Attribute geben lassen?
-
Das ist immer noch kein 70 Std. Projekt, denn du willst laut Antrag sowohl die Erfassung und Priorisierung von neuen Anforderungen Umsetzen sowie die User/Gruppen spezifische Aufbereitung der Daten. Dein Zeitplan gibt auch nur recht wenig Aufschluss darüber was du nun eigentlich umsetzen willst. Denn jetzt entwickelst du 16 Std. lang ein Modul nur was da entwickelt wird ist nicht klar. Denn die Erfassung und die Anzeige der Daten sind zwei paar Schuhe also eigentlich auch zwei Module. Dann kommen noch 10 Std. Pixel schieben hinzu das ist in meinen Augen zu viel. Denn das schaut für mich so aus als würdest du eine ganze Menge deiner Business-Logik in die View verlagern. Zudem sind 42 Std. für die Realisierung schon arg grenzwertig zumal deine Planung vor der Realisierung doch recht kurz ist.
-
Beschreibe mal bitte etwas genauer was du genau umsetzen willst. Denn so wie es im Moment im Antrag steht glaube ich nicht das es in 70 Std. zu schaffen ist. Selbst wenn du bereits vorhandene Komponenten zurück greifen kannst. Die Realisierung insgesamt schaut für mich nicht wirklich schlüssig aus. Für das Grundsystem willst du 13 Std. brauchen dann noch 17 Std. für Templates. Wo werden die Daten gespeichert wann wird die benötigte Datenhaltung geplant? Was du unter Grundsystem versteht wird auch nicht wirklich klar. Hinzu kommt das dein Zeitplan für die Realisierung mir zu grob ist und für die Doku wird zu viel Zeit verplant.
-
Da ich mich bis jetzt nicht mir Groovy auseinander gesetzt habe hier mal der Java Code. DocumentBuilder builder = DocumentBuilderFactory.newInstance().newDocumentBuilder(); Document doc = builder.parse("src/forum.xml"); XPath xpath = XPathFactory.newInstance().newXPath(); NodeList nodes = (NodeList) xpath.evaluate("//customfield[@id='customfield_10055']/customfieldvalues/customfieldvalue", doc, XPathConstants.NODESET); for (int i = 0; i < nodes.getLength(); i++) { System.out.println(nodes.item(i).getTextContent()); }
-
Du kannst dir per XPath-Ausdruck deinen benötigten Knoten selektieren und dann deinen Text ausgeben. //customfield[@id='customfield_10055']/customfieldvalues/customfieldvalue
-
Projektdoku - Komplexe Entscheidungen??
Schiller256 antwortete auf Tastenstreichler's Thema in Abschlussprojekte
Da wäre ich Vorsichtig denn ich würde mir im Fachgespräch schon erklären lassen wieso gerade diese Sprache oder das Framework ausgewählt wurde. Da kannst du recht schnell, wenn du schon in der einen Sprache/im Framework nicht sicher bist, ins schwimmen geraten.